A nineteenth century French chandelier The nineteenth century was a period of excellent modifications and growth; the economic revolution and the growth of wealth with the industries tremendously increased the market for chandeliers, new methods of lighting and superior techniques of output emerged. Other nations for example The usa also commenced producing chandeliers; the first American chandelier is considered to date from 1804.[59] New designs and more complex and elaborate chandeliers also appeared, and manufacture of chandeliers reached a peak during the 19th century.

Chandeliers in Hagia Sophia, similar lighting devices could are actually existing within the Byzantine interval The early kind of hanging lighting devices in religious properties could be of appreciable size. Big hanging lamps in Hagia Sophia ended up explained by Paul the Silentiary in 563:[21] "And beneath each chain he has induced to get fitted silver discs, hanging circle-wise in the air, around the Place in the middle of your church. As a result these discs, pendant from their lofty courses, form a coronet earlier mentioned the heads of men. They have been pierced way too via the weapon on the skillful workman, so as they may well get shafts of fireplace-wrought glass and maintain gentle on high for men during the night time.
